In November, the average temperature in West Long Branch, United States is a crisp 9°C (49°F), with minima dipping as low as -7°C (20°F) and maxima soaring up to 22°C (72°F). Expect some wet days, as precipitation averages around 100 mm (3.9 in) over 10 days, coupled with a relatively high humidity level of 82%. UV Risk Categories

  •  Extreme (11+): Avoid the sun, stay in shade.
  •  Very High (8-10): Limit sun exposure.
  •  High (6-7): Use SPF 30+ and protective clothing.
  •  Moderate (3-5): Midday shade recommended.
  •  Low (0-2): No protection needed.
